Cheryl Chin (born November 11, 1979) is an American television and film actress, as well as a fashion model. She was formerly known as a Singapore television actress and fashion model who competed in and won the Star Search Singapore finals in 2003. She also walked away with the best actress award.[1]

She has appeared mostly on Singapore's television drama and comedy series and is best known for her role as Lina Zhang in The Best Bet (the television series) which aired in February of 2005.

Biography

Cheryl Chin was born and raised in Singapore till the age of 13 before her family migrated to the USA in 2001. At 21 years of age, she put her studies on hold and returned to Singapore to pursue a career in acting.

Her first television debut was in 2002 as Angel Tan on the popular English comedy; School Days. Shortly after, in 2003, she emerged as Singapore's Female Champion in Star Search Singapore and received her first dramatic role in An Ode To Life as Weng Xiaoyun, a muddle-headed nurse who unexpectedly falls into a love triangle. An ode to life aired in 2004 on Mediacorp Television and later won the best dramatic television series award.

She went on to star in the 13 episode comedy series "The Cheer Team" which aired in 2004 as Miss Bai, a cheerleading teacher that was most inappropriate for the job. While shooting "The Cheer Team", she was offered a role on a would be popular teen idol television series. Two weeks into training, she was offered another role on and "The Best Bet", a 14 episode Singaporean television series as Lina Zhang, the love interest of both Christopher Lee's and Mark Lee's characters.

As her contract with Mediacorp, Singapore's national television studios came to an end in 2004, she wrapped up filming on "The Best Bet" and left back to America. The reason she gave was that she misses her family.
